Tracing the Digital Footprint: From Telemedicine to Telehealth Platforms

The roots of telehealth stretch back decades, yet the journey to today’s sophisticated platforms has been punctuated by technological leaps and shifting healthcare paradigms. Early telemedicine initiatives of the late 20th century primarily focused on bridging geographical gaps for rural populations, using simple phone and video links to connect patients with distant specialists.

However, these efforts were often fragmented—lacking integration with electronic health records (EHRs), limited in scope, and constrained by bandwidth and regulatory uncertainty. The explosion of broadband internet and smartphone ubiquity in the 2010s laid the groundwork for more robust solutions. The COVID-19 pandemic accelerated this trend dramatically, forcing health systems worldwide to adopt telehealth as a primary mode of care delivery almost overnight.

By 2026, telehealth platforms have transcended basic virtual visits to incorporate a suite of functionalities: remote patient monitoring, AI-driven symptom triage, personalized health coaching, and seamless data integration across providers. This evolution reflects both technological advancements and a growing recognition that healthcare must adapt to patient lifestyles, emphasizing continuous engagement rather than episodic encounters.

Several key developments shaped this trajectory:

  • Regulatory Flexibility: Temporary waivers during the pandemic opened pathways for reimbursement and interstate practice, many of which have been made permanent.
  • Interoperability Standards: Initiatives to unify health data formats enabled smoother information exchange, enhancing continuity of care.
  • AI and Analytics: Integration of decision-support tools improved diagnostic accuracy and personalized treatment recommendations.
  • Wearables and IoT Devices: Proliferation of connected health gadgets allowed real-time monitoring and early intervention.

Data, Design, and Diagnostics: The Anatomy of Modern Telehealth Platforms

The sophistication of today’s telehealth platforms lies in their marriage of data science, user-centric design, and clinical workflows. Unlike early video-only systems, modern platforms operate as integrated hubs that collect, analyze, and act on diverse health data streams.

Consider the following pillars underpinning these platforms:

  1. Unified Health Records: Platforms employ cloud-based, interoperable EHR systems that consolidate patient history, lab results, imaging, and medication data in real time. According to ITWeb, unified health records are critical for transforming patient care, enabling practitioners to make informed decisions quickly and reducing errors.
  2. AI-Enhanced Clinical Decision Support: Machine learning algorithms sift through vast datasets to identify patterns, flag anomalies, and suggest diagnostic possibilities. This reduces clinician cognitive load and can uncover subtle signs that might be missed in traditional settings.
  3. Remote Monitoring and IoT: Devices such as smart blood pressure cuffs, glucose monitors, and even wearable ECG patches feed continuous data, allowing for proactive care management of chronic conditions.
  4. Personalized Patient Interfaces: Platforms tailor the user experience based on patient literacy, language preferences, and health goals. This includes interactive symptom checkers, medication reminders, and educational content.
  5. Secure Communication Channels: End-to-end encryption and multi-factor authentication safeguard sensitive information while supporting synchronous and asynchronous interactions between patients and providers.

Statistics highlight the impact: a 2025 survey by the American Telemedicine Association revealed that 72% of patients reported improved management of chronic diseases through telehealth, and 85% of providers noted enhanced workflow efficiency. Furthermore, teledermatology—a specialty that lends itself well to visual diagnostics—has seen patient satisfaction rates soar, as detailed in the International Business Times report on telemedicine’s transformation of dermatology care.

“The integration of AI with patient-generated data is shifting telehealth from reactive consultation to continuous care,” explains a leading health tech researcher at Stanford University.

2026 Milestones: Innovations and Industry Shifts Reshaping Care

This year marks a watershed moment in telehealth’s maturation. Noteworthy advances and strategic moves are redefining what these platforms can offer and how they fit into broader healthcare ecosystems.

Among the most significant 2026 developments:

  • Neuro-Oncology Digital Care Models: The Mayo Clinic's recent digital transformation in brain cancer care integrates telehealth with genomic data and personalized treatment protocols, a pioneering approach spotlighted by MobiHealthNews.
  • Expansion of Telehealth into Rural and Underserved Areas: Programs like Amana Care Clinic in Muscatine, Iowa, are extending specialist access through telehealth, overcoming long-standing geographic and socioeconomic barriers, as reported by Detroit Free Press.
  • Regulatory and Reimbursement Evolution: The Centers for Medicare and Medicaid Services have broadened coverage for remote patient monitoring and teletherapy services, removing former caps and streamlining claims processing.
  • Consolidation and Partnerships: Major health systems are partnering with tech giants to co-develop platforms that embed AI diagnostics and predictive analytics into electronic health records, fostering an ecosystem approach rather than siloed solutions.
  • Focus on Mental Health Integration: Telehealth platforms now routinely include behavioral health modules, combining chatbots, video counseling, and crisis intervention tools, reflecting a holistic approach to wellness.

These developments underscore a shift from viewing telehealth as a supplementary service to recognizing it as a central pillar of comprehensive care. The ongoing digitalization also invites scrutiny of privacy frameworks and ethical considerations, challenges that stakeholders grapple with as technology embeds deeper into patient lives.

Voices from the Frontlines: Expert Perspectives on Telehealth’s Impact

To understand the real-world implications of telehealth’s evolution, I spoke with clinicians, health IT specialists, and patient advocates who illuminated both its promise and pitfalls.

Dr. Elena Ramirez, a family physician in Austin, Texas, shared,

“Telehealth has transformed how I connect with patients. I can monitor their vitals remotely, intervene earlier, and tailor treatments more precisely. But it requires new skills—digital empathy, tech literacy—and a rethinking of the healer-patient relationship.”

From the technology side, Rajesh Patel, CTO of a major telehealth provider, emphasized interoperability challenges:

“Building platforms that talk seamlessly to legacy hospital systems and consumer wearables is complex. Yet it’s the only way to create a truly continuous patient record that supports informed decisions.”

Patient advocates highlight accessibility concerns. While telehealth reduces travel burdens, it risks excluding those without reliable internet or digital skills. Initiatives focusing on digital inclusion and multilingual support are critical to prevent new disparities.

These expert voices converge on one theme: telehealth’s transformation is multifaceted and requires collaboration across clinical, technical, and policy domains to realize its full potential.

Looking Ahead: What to Watch in Telehealth’s Next Chapter

As telehealth platforms continue to mature, several trends and challenges will define their trajectory over the coming years:

  1. Augmented Reality (AR) and Virtual Reality (VR): Emerging tools promise immersive diagnostics and rehabilitation experiences, enhancing remote physical therapy and surgical consultations.
  2. Advanced AI for Predictive Care: Algorithms will move beyond diagnosis to anticipate disease progression and recommend preemptive interventions.
  3. Greater Patient Control Over Data: Decentralized health data models, possibly leveraging blockchain, could empower patients with ownership and consent management of their health information.
  4. Integration of Social Determinants of Health (SDOH): Platforms will increasingly incorporate environmental, economic, and social data to personalize care beyond biology.
  5. Policy and Ethical Frameworks: Governments and organizations will need to craft nuanced regulations balancing innovation, privacy, and equity.

To navigate this rapidly shifting terrain, stakeholders must foster adaptable infrastructures, invest in digital literacy, and promote inclusive design. The potential payoff is immense—a healthcare system that is not only more efficient but deeply attuned to the rhythms of individual lives.
